> On Tue, Oct 19, 2021 at 07:06:42AM +0100, Mauro Carvalho Chehab wrote:
> > Before code refactor, the PERST# signals were sent at the
> > end of the power_on logic. Then, the PCI core would probe for
> > the buses and add them.
> >
> > The new logic changed it to send PERST# signals during
> > add_bus operation. That altered the timings.
> >
> > Also, HiKey 970 require a little more waiting time for
> > the PCI bridge - which is outside the SoC - to finish
> > the PERST# reset, and then initialize the eye diagram.

> > So, increase the waiting time for the PERST# signals to
> > what's required for it to also work with HiKey 970.
